xlwt模块【xlwt写入Excel】

xlwt写入Excel

import xlwt

#创建工作簿
wb = xlwt.Workbook()

#创建工作表
ws = wb.add_sheet("CNY")

#填充工作表的内容
#write_merge合并并写入
ws.write_merge(0,1,0,5,"2019年货币兑换表")

#写入的数据
data = (("姓名1","学号","地址","联系方式","备注"),
    ("姓名2","学号","地址","联系方式","备注"),
    ("姓名3","学号","地址","联系方式","备注"),)
#遍历行,使用enumerate()产生序数
for i,item in enumerate(data):
    #在遍历每行的元素添加
    for j,val in enumerate(item):
        #数据写入
        ws.write(i+2,j,val)

#创建第二个工作表
wsimg = wb.add_sheet("image")

#插入位图,名称 行 列
wsimg.insert_bitmap("mm.bmp",0,0)

#保存文件,仅仅支持xls,不支持xlsx
wb.save("2019会计表.xls")

xlwt再写入Excel首先使用Workbook()创建工作簿,然后使用add_sheet创建工作表,使用write()函数写入,然后save()保存文件,参数中文件的后缀仅仅支持xls文件格式,也可以使用工作表对象方法insert_bitmap()插入位图,图片后缀仅仅支持bmp

 

posted @ 2022-09-26 12:30  Crown-V  阅读(71)  评论(0)    收藏  举报